NVIDIA Placement Guide

Semiconductors — AI & Accelerated Computing · Santa Clara, USA (India: Bengaluru, Hyderabad, Pune) · ~30,000 employees · Founded 1993

NVIDIA is the world leader in GPUs and accelerated computing, powering the generative-AI boom with its data-centre chips and CUDA software. India hosts large engineering and research teams.

Eligibility criteria

Typically 7.0+ CGPA, strong DSA/problem-solving. CS or allied branches preferred for SDE; open branches for analyst roles. Internship conversions common.

Hiring timeline

On-campus Aug–Oct for finals; summer internship hiring Jul–Sep for pre-finals. Offer to joining: 6–11 months.

Interview Process

Stage-by-stage, with tips and sample questions

1

Online Assessment

Timed coding test on a platform (HackerRank/Codility) with 2–3 DSA problems and sometimes MCQs on CS fundamentals.

Tips
  • Solve 150–250 LeetCode problems (easy→medium→hard)
  • Master arrays, strings, trees, graphs, DP
  • Dry-run edge cases before submitting
Sample questions
  • Two-pointer / sliding-window array problem
  • Tree traversal / lowest common ancestor
  • Dynamic programming (knapsack/LIS variant)
  • MCQs on time complexity & OS
2

Technical Round (DSA)

Live coding with an engineer. You explain your approach, optimise complexity, and write working code.

Tips
  • Think out loud — communication is scored
  • State brute force, then optimise
  • Discuss time & space complexity explicitly
Sample questions
  • Design an LRU cache
  • Detect a cycle in a linked list
  • Number of islands (BFS/DFS)
  • Find median of two sorted arrays
3

System / Design Round

For some roles: high-level design or low-level design (machine-coding) to test scalability and OOP modelling.

Tips
  • Learn fundamentals: load balancing, caching, sharding, queues
  • Clarify requirements before designing
  • Discuss trade-offs, not just one answer
Sample questions
  • Design a URL shortener
  • Design a rate limiter
  • Low-level design of a parking lot
  • How would you scale a notification system?
4

Behavioral / Bar-Raiser Round

Values and leadership-principles based. Uses your past experiences to predict how you work.

Tips
  • Prepare 6–8 STAR stories (Situation-Task-Action-Result)
  • Map stories to the company’s leadership principles
  • Show ownership, data-driven decisions, and impact
Sample questions
  • Tell me about a time you disagreed with a teammate.
  • Describe your most challenging project.
  • A time you took ownership beyond your role.
  • How do you prioritise when everything is urgent?
